TVS Apache leads the top selling 150cc bikes chart in June 2017 despite a fall in sales of 12 percent.

Top Selling 150cc Bikes In June 2017

The automobile industry awaited the nation’s biggest tax reform since Independence, the GST. The majority of customers postponed their purchases and a look at the chart above is evident. Except the Suzuki Gixxer, Yamaha SZ and Honda CB Unicorn 160, every other contender in the top selling list has seen a downfall in sales.

The TVS Apache sold 32,742 units in June 2017 and held onto the first spot. Following the TVS Apache is its close rival, the Bajaj Pulsar 150. The Pulsar 150 numbers have seen a drastic downfall. Bajaj sold 23,829 units of the Pulsar 150 in June 2017 as opposed to 36,118 units in May 2017. The Pulsar 150 has been selling in the Indian market for over a decade now. Sales numbers of the TVS Apache series include the RTR 160, 180 and 200 as the company doesn’t disclose individual sales numbers.

At the third spot is yet another motorcycle that has been selling since over a decade, the Honda CB Unicorn 150. Honda sold 17,231 units of the CB Unicorn 150 in June 2017. Yamaha’s best-selling motorcycle, the FZ sits at the fourth spot selling 14,222 units while one of its close rivals, the Honda CB Hornet 160R sold 9567 units in June 2017.

The Hero Achiever clinches the sixth spot from the Bajaj V15, selling 6182 units. The V15 slips to the seventh spot and sold just 5877 units in June 2017 as compared to 11,315 units in May 2017. The Bajaj V15 saw a drop in sales by over 45 percent. Following the V15 is the Suzuki Gixxer, Honda CB Unicorn 160 and Yamaha SZ that sold 5500, 3728 and 3362 units respectively. In fact these are the only three motorcycles in the chart above that have seen a growth in sales.

The Bajaj Avenger, Yamaha R15 and Hero Xtreme sold 3035, 2985 and 1753 units respectively in the month of June 2017. On close observation, not only the Pulsar 150, V15 and Avenger 150, but almost the entire portfolio of Bajaj 2-wheelers (except Pulsar 180, NS 200 and RS 200) have seen a drastic downfall in sales. Bajaj seems to have noted this and hence the recent announcement from the Pulsar maker that it will launch new motorcycles under all its 7 brands by December this year.
